원격 데스크톱-RDP 빈 화면 및 연결 해제 후 중단


12

주의 : 나는 많은 질문을 스크롤했지만 답변을 찾지 못했습니다. 이것을 중복으로 표시하지 마십시오! 비슷한 질문이 이미 있지만 슬프게도 아무런 대답도 얻지 못했습니다.

Windows 10 PC에서 Odroid XU4에 연결하려고하는데 연결이 완료된 후 (적어도 가정합니다) Windows PC의 화면이 몇 초 동안 회색으로 바뀌고 오류없이 사라집니다. 메시지. 리눅스 머신에‘xrdp’를 설치했습니다. 다음은 3 단계입니다.

자격 증명 삽입 : 여기에 이미지 설명을 입력하십시오

연결 구축 : 여기에 이미지 설명을 입력하십시오

무음 중단 직전의 빈 화면 : 여기에 이미지 설명을 입력하십시오

## 아 버트 ##

편집 이것은 syslog 출력입니다.

Oct  3 08:25:18 odroid systemd[1]: Starting Session c4 of user odroid.
Oct  3 08:25:19 odroid org.a11y.Bus[2241]: Activating service name='org.a11y.atspi.Registry'
Oct  3 08:25:19 odroid org.a11y.Bus[2241]: Successfully activated service 'org.a11y.atspi.Registry'
Oct  3 08:25:19 odroid org.a11y.atspi.Registry[2283]: SpiRegistry daemon is running with well-known name - org.a11y.atspi.Registry
Oct  3 08:25:19 odroid gnome-session[2197]: gnome-session-is-accelerated: No composite extension.
Oct  3 08:25:19 odroid gnome-session[2197]: gnome-session-check-accelerated: Helper exited with code 256
Oct  3 08:25:24 odroid gnome-session[2197]: gnome-session-is-accelerated: No composite extension.
Oct  3 08:25:24 odroid gnome-session[2197]: gnome-session-check-accelerated: Helper exited with code 256
Oct  3 08:25:24 odroid gnome-session[2197]: x-session-manager[2197]: WARNING: software acceleration check failed: Child process exited with code 1
Oct  3 08:25:24 odroid x-session-manager[2197]: WARNING: software acceleration check failed: Child process exited with code 1
Oct  3 08:25:24 odroid x-session-manager[2197]: CRITICAL: We failed, but the fail whale is dead. Sorry....
Oct  3 08:25:24 odroid gnome-session[2197]: x-session-manager[2197]: CRITICAL: We failed, but the fail whale is dead. Sorry....
Oct  3 08:25:24 odroid org.a11y.atspi.Registry[2283]: XIO:  fatal IO error 11 (Resource temporarily unavailable) on X server ":10.0"
Oct  3 08:25:24 odroid org.a11y.atspi.Registry[2283]: after 11 requests (11 known processed) with 0 events remaining.
Oct  3 08:25:24 odroid org.gtk.vfs.Daemon[2241]: A connection to the bus can't be made
Oct  3 08:25:24 odroid org.gtk.vfs.Daemon[2241]: g_dbus_connection_real_closed: Remote peer vanished with error: Underlying GIOStream returned 0 bytes on an async read (g-io-error-quark, 0). Exiting.
Oct  3 08:25:24 odroid org.a11y.Bus[2241]: g_dbus_connection_real_closed: Remote peer vanished with error: Underlying GIOStream returned 0 bytes on an async read (g-io-error-quark, 0). Exiting.

xrdp가 문제가 있는지 로그를 확인 했습니까? 나는 보통 상자에 넣은 다음 해당 터미널에서 rdp 서버를 실행 한 다음 rdp를 입력하고 터미널 출력을보고 rdp가 문제에 대해 불평했는지 확인합니다. 처음에 도움이되지 않으면 xrdp를 더 자세한 모드로 실행하고 syslog (/ var / log / syslog)를 확인하십시오.
sibaz

@ sibaz syslog 출력을 질문에 넣었습니다. 이것이 무엇을 의미하는지 추측 할 수 있습니까? 소프트웨어 가속 프로세스가 중지 되었습니까? 이 문제가 잘못된 포트를 통해 관련 될 수 있다고 생각하십니까? 모든 것을 원격으로 로그인 할 수 있지만 나중에 충돌이 발생합니다.
codepleb


글쎄, 아마도 하드웨어가 하드웨어 가속을 사용하고 있기 때문에 아마도 '소프트웨어 가속 검사'가 실패하여 x-session-manager가 실패하고 xrdp가 소프트웨어에서 그것을 모방하는 방법을 모른다는 것입니다 (완전한 추측으로) . o9000의 의견에 따르면 xrdp는 화합처럼 보이지 않는 단일성 또는 그놈과는 작동하지 않지만 사실이라면 문제가 될 것입니다. 다른 vnc 클라이언트를 시도하거나 다른 창 관리자를 사용해보십시오. KDE (및 kdrc / krfb)를 사용하지만 정확히 작지는 않습니다.
sibaz

답변:


11

이 줄을 터미널에 넣은 후에 해결책을 찾았습니다.

echo mate-session> ~/.xsession

그래도 문제가 해결되지 않으면 다음 명령을 시도하십시오.

sudo apt-get install mate-core

(확실하지는 않지만 hardkernel에 의해 사전 컴파일 된 수정 된 우분투를 사용했습니다. Mate는 데스크탑 환경이었습니다.하지만 기존의 업데이트뿐만 아니라 메이트 코어를 "새로"설치할 수있었습니다. 아마도 이것이 문제였습니다.)


포트 3389에 RDP가 없습니까? 포트 포워딩을하고 있습니까?
j0h

@ j0h : 예 포트 포워딩을했습니다. 물론 로컬 네트워크 외부에서 액세스해야하는 경우에만 그렇게하면됩니다.
codepleb

mate-session 오류 발생 : ** (mate-session : 11853) : 경고 ** : 디스플레이를 열 수 없음 :
stiv

OH : RDP를 통해 PC에 액세스하기 위해 루트 계정을 사용하지 말고 새 계정을 만들어 메이트 세션을 호출하는 데 사용하십시오
stiv

0

또 다른 옵션은 Parallels 클라이언트를 시도하는 것입니다.

구해서 설치하는 방법에 대한 지침은 여기에서 찾을 수 있습니다 : http://kb.parallels.com/en/123304을 (그들은 쉽게 인생을 만들기 위해 뎁 패키지를 제공합니다 :).)


0

GNOME 3 의이 버그 때문 입니다. KDE와 같은 다른 데스크탑 환경을 사용할 수 있습니다.


1
KDE를 사용하여 재현 할 수도 있습니다
clobrano

당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.